N1 - 25 N2 - Teachers usually consider their work as an opportunity to transmit knowledge. A recent study conducted with secondary school teachers, before and after teaching experience, shows an evolution characterized by the necessity of maintaining fulfilling teacher-student relationships, in which feelings of mutual trust are key. In addition, pedagogical methods are undergoing a tremendous change, in which digital technologies are playing a major role. This research investigates the possibility of assessing teacher satisfaction today in view of the professional development of teachers, who face unpredicted socio-educational issues when they enter the profession. Therefore, the way in which professional identity is submitted to a subjectivation process depends on the meaning granted to teaching activity, based upon its usefulness.
